Transaction d93fb696acaf6da72520383e22480ce1dcd1269ed4749383f3d3d6a2ec0f8ef2
1 Input
1 Output
-
d93fb696acaf6da72520383e22480ce1dcd1269ed4749383f3d3d6a2ec0f8ef2:0
- value
- 176021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dab52bae045444ac01e407829f448aac93659429 OP_EQUAL
- address
- 3MdSGKRSDMdEuSdSrjnGrokuu4vgws5dcY